What is Methusalem?


1.

Methusalem is a term for a wine bottle size in champagne. It holds six liters, which is nearly 1.6 U.S. gallons.

The methusalem (or methusalah) bottle has the shape of a burgundy wine bottle, that is, from its cylindrical bottom it tapers gently (doesn't have "shoulders" as a bordeaux wine bottle does) to its top.
